Brenda Quiroz, LMFT

“LMFT, Friend, Advocate”

Brenda Quiroz is a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ist. She earned her Bachelor of Arts degree in psychology from California State University of Fresno. She went on to graduate from National University of Fresno with a Master’s of Arts degree in Counseling Psychology. Brenda uses effective evidenced based techniques, such as Trauma Focused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(TF-CBT), Dialectal Behavioral Therapy (DBT), Motivational Interviewing (MI) and Parent Child Interactive Therapy (PCIT) to develop awareness, shift unhelpful patterns, confront fears and adopt healthier habits.

Brenda’s extensive clinical experience includes working with children, adolescents, adults, and families with different cultures and socioeconomic backgrounds in the outpatient setting. She has a passion for helping others and possess years of treating symptoms related to trauma, depression, stress, and anxiety, providing support to improve her client’s overall well-being.

Brenda believes that change happens within a strong, supportive and collaborative therapeutic relationship, where she meets her patients where they are at in their life journey. Here treatments are rooted in client centered and cognitive behavioral theories. Based on the individual goals and needs of each patient, she integrates mindfulness based interventions, trauma focused therapy, or cognitive behavioral therapy in order to support her patients healing process.

Outside of providing therapy, she enjoys spending time with family, friends, being active outdoors with her two dogs and being a mother.
